This thesis has investigated oxygen uptake ( i r02) kinetic regulation during whole body exercise by investigating not only the breath-by-breath V O ~ response to a change in work rate but also incorporating an examination of data analysis processes and simulation of a physiological V O ~ model. Five experiments have been completed to answer the following questions: Experiment 1: What effects do sample duration, ensembling, interpolation, and smoothing have on time constant determination? Experiment 2: Is the slope of the V O ~ response to a ramp work rate altered by changing the inspired fraction of oxygen? Experiment 3: Does glycogen depletion acutely reduce the rate of carbohydrate utilization and thus quicken the VO;? time constant? Experiment 4: Does one-legged training alter the h2 time constant of the trained and the untrained leg differently? Experiment 5: With respect to the muscle 6 7 0 ~ time constant, does expansion of an accepted physiological model of oxygen uptake to include a heterogeneous muscle compartment significantly alter modeled V% kinetics? Experiment 1 demonstrated that a more accurate ?oz time constant estimation from a step increase in work rate can be acquired by artificially extending the steady state portion of the vo2 response. Experiment 2 showed that, above the anaerobic threshold, the A ~ O ~ A W R relation, relative to nornloxia, is increased in hyperoxia and decreased in hypoxia. This suggests that a change in AVWAWR above the anaerobic threshold is related to the recruitment pattern of muscle units and their kinetic characteristics rather than simply the onset of anaerobiosis. In experiment 3 there was no difference in the V O ~ kinetic response of the glycogen-depleted state compared with a normal glycogen state. This indicates that rleither the physiological nor biochemical changes induced by glycogen depletion 3nected ?02 kinetics.
